Everglades Wonder Gardens Map 2025
In 2025, Everglades Wonder Gardens undertook notable operational updates. The otter exhibit was rebuilt, and broader upgrades to animal enclosures were carried out under new leadership as the facility transitioned into a non-profit. Admission fees, which remained at 2023 levels of $12 for adults, $7 for children, and $10 for seniors, were scheduled to rise by $2 with the opening of the Elevated Boardwalk later in the year.

FAQ
What is there to do in the Wonder Gardens?
At Everglades Wonder Gardens, visitors can feed flamingos, see rescued alligators and turtles, and walk through lush botanical gardens. Attractions include bird aviaries, reptile exhibits, butterfly areas, and shaded trails. Guests also enjoy interactive animal encounters and educational displays that highlight Florida wildlife and tropical plant species.
What is the history of the Wonder Gardens in the Everglades?
Everglades Wonder Gardens opened in 1936 in Bonita Springs as a roadside attraction. Originally created by brothers Bill and Lester Piper, it showcased Florida wildlife and tropical gardens to travelers along the Tamiami Trail. Over time, it grew into a community landmark, preserving rescued animals and historic botanical collections.
How much is Wonder Gardens?
Admission to Everglades Wonder Gardens costs about $15 for adults and $10 for children ages 3–12. Seniors and military members typically receive discounted entry around $12. Children under 3 enter free. Additional experiences such as animal feedings may require a small extra fee.
